We know, we know—it’s shocking. But, what goes around comes around, and Bermuda shorts are back! Arguably, this is the summer of the silhouette. The return of this nostalgic style proves that longer hemlines can be just as chic as a midi skirt or dress—albeit more unexpected.

While once exclusive to skateboarders for their ease of movement, thanks to a crop of particular designers’ spring/summer 2026 collections—from Dries Van Noten, to Khaite and TWP—they’ve caught the eye of the fashion set, too. We saw a handful of styles, from pleated to lace-trimmed on the streets during men’s fashion week, confirming their status as a summer power player.
Bermuda shorts’ rise to sartorial stardom comes as little surprise: the appeal lies in their versatility. Unlike shorter styles, which can feel trend-dependent or best suited for off-duty plans, Bermuda shorts seamlessly adapt to a variety of aesthetics, and can be worn to a plethora of occasions. Think of minimalist tailoring paired with an oversized button-down for a relaxed yet polished look at the office. Or, picture them with raffia accessories for a chic, summer-in-the-city vibe. The result, regardless of how it’s worn, is a silhouette that feels both modern and practical, offering just enough coverage without sacrificing style.

A Pleated White Short + Cape + Playful Accessories
A pair of crisp white Bermuda shorts grounds this look with an air of effortless sophistication, while a flowing black summer cape adds drama and movement. Vertigo’s beaded bracelet and Le Sundial’s tasseled cord belt add a touch of texture and personality.
